The Princeton Symphony Orchestra opens its 2024-25 season on September 14-15 with performances of Tchaikovsky's Violin Concerto featuring violinist Aubree Oliverson as soloist. Under the direction of Maestro Rossen Milanov, the program also includes Gemma Peacocke's Manta, performed alongside members of the Youth Orchestra of Central Jersey, and Brahms' Symphony No. 4. The concerts take place at Richardson Auditorium on the Princeton University campus.
